Insertion loss, commonly referred to as attenuation, represents the reduction in signal strength as it passes through a medium such as a cable or connector. This measure is vital for understanding signal availability in transmission systems.

When insertion loss is present, it indicates that the signal has lost some of its strength during transmission. Therefore, a higher insertion loss correlates with less available signal reaching the receiving end. This decrease in signal availability can lead to poorer performance in communication systems, resulting in issues such as slower data rates or increased error rates.
